When Pipelined Streaming I/O is selected and no cyclic prefix is used, the core can overlap the loading of a frame with the processing and unloading of earlier frames. If the upstream master supplies the first symbol for a new frame immediately after the last symbol for the previous frame, the core starts loading it immediately.

The following figure shows the general timing for back-to-back frames in the Pipelined Streaming architecture.

Figure 1. Transform Timing for Entire Frames in Pipelined Streaming I/O with no Cyclic Prefix Insertion

There is a latency between a frame being loaded and the processed data for that frame being available. This latency depends on the options chosen in the Vivado IDE to parameterize the core. However, when that latency has passed, processed frames appear back-to-back.
